Ocugen Faces Critical Funding Timeline as Pipeline Advances

The biotechnology firm Ocugen finds itself in a pivotal position, balancing promising clinical progress against a rapidly diminishing cash reserve. Current financial projections indicate the company’s funds will only sustain operations until mid-2026, creating a pressing need for additional capital infusion or the full exercise of outstanding warrants to avoid a financial shortfall.

Financial Position Under Scrutiny

Ocugen’s third-quarter 2025 financial report highlighted a concerning liquidity trend. By the end of September, the company’s cash and equivalents had dwindled to $32.9 million, representing a significant decrease from the $58.8 million reported at the close of 2024. With quarterly operating expenses running at $19.4 million, the company is consuming its financial resources at an accelerated pace.

In response to this tightening liquidity, Ocugen secured approximately $20 million through a capital raise during the third quarter. Company leadership maintains that existing cash reserves are sufficient to fund operations through the second quarter of 2026. A potential financial buffer exists through outstanding warrants, which if fully exercised could inject an additional $30 million into corporate coffers, potentially extending the company’s financial runway into 2027. However, this remains contingent on warrant holders choosing to exercise their options.

Ambitious Regulatory Strategy

The company’s financial pressure is compounded by an aggressive regulatory timeline. Ocugen has committed to submitting three Biologics License Applications (BLAs) within the coming three years, a ambitious goal that hinges entirely on the success of its gene therapy candidates targeting inherited retinal diseases.

Key developmental milestones include:

  • OCU400: Patient recruitment for the Phase 3 clinical trial is nearing completion, with BLA and Marketing Authorization Application (MAA) submissions targeted for 2026. This program represents the company’s first tangible opportunity for product commercialization.

  • OCU410ST: The pivotal Phase 2/3 study has reached the halfway mark in patient enrollment. Management aims to complete recruitment by the first quarter of 2026, followed by a BLA submission in the first half of 2027.

  • European Regulatory Breakthrough: The company achieved a significant regulatory advantage with the European Medicines Agency (EMA), which agreed to accept a single U.S. study for OCU410ST for European approval. This decision potentially saves both time and substantial financial resources.

Strategic Partnerships and Recent Performance

To diversify its funding strategy beyond equity offerings, Ocugen entered an exclusive licensing agreement with South Korean pharmaceutical company Kwangdong for OCU400. This partnership provides up to $7.5 million in upfront payments and development milestones, plus royalty payments amounting to 25% of net sales in South Korea.

The company’s third-quarter financial results presented a mixed picture. Ocugen reported a loss of $0.07 per share, missing analyst expectations, while revenue of $1.75 million slightly exceeded projections. The commercial launch of OCU400 is tentatively scheduled for 2027, assuming both adequate financing and successful regulatory review based on compelling clinical data.
